GPS technology company Catapult - which develops wearable devices sewn into the back of players' shirts - recently aimed to deepen the use of data in rugby by launching a unique set of algorithms engineered to quantify key technical and physical demands in the sport. A fondness for technology is good for players, fans and the game Rugby league's switch from winter to summer sport in 1996 arose partly to secure small-screen exposure.
